BIyth, Northumberland. — 7th September.

A small boat sank in Hartley Bay, but her crew were rescued by men from St. Mary's Island lighthouse.— Rewards, £8 8s..

Length 10m (32ft 9in) Beam 3.7m (12ft 2in) Displacement Approx 9 tonnes Speed 18.6 knots Range 140 n. miles Crew 4 Construction Glass Reinforced Plastic (GRP). - View image in PDF
